c语言开发工具有哪些?🤔新手必备神器推荐!✨-c语言-EDUC教育网
教育
教育网
学习留学移民英语学校教育
联系我们SITEMAP
教育学习c语言

c语言开发工具有哪些?🤔新手必备神器推荐!✨

2026-03-27 20:01:53 发布

c语言开发工具有哪些?🤔新手必备神器推荐!✨, ,从初学者到专业开发者,C语言开发工具种类繁多。本文为你盘点主流的C语言开发工具,并结合实际使用体验分享如何选择适合自己的工具,助你轻松入门、高效进阶!

一、什么是C语言开发工具?💡

什么是C语言开发工具呢?,简单来说,C语言开发工具是用来编写、调试和运行C语言程序的软件或环境。它们就像厨师的锅铲一样重要——没有合适的工具,再好的食材也难以做出美味佳肴!😄常见的C语言开发工具包括集成开发环境(IDE)、代码编辑器和编译器等。
举个例子:如果你刚学完“Hello World”,但不知道用什么工具来写代码,那就太遗憾啦!别担心,接下来我会逐一介绍几款超好用的C语言开发工具,总有一款适合你!

二、主流C语言开发工具大盘点📋

有哪些主流的C语言开发工具呢?,以下是一些经典的C语言开发工具,每款都有其独特的优势:
1️⃣ Visual Studio Code (VS Code): 这是一款轻量级但功能强大的代码编辑器,支持多种编程语言,尤其是搭配C/C++插件后,简直就是C语言开发者的福音!它界面简洁、扩展性强,还自带Git版本控制功能,简直是“全能型选手”。而且完全免费哦!🎉
2️⃣ Dev-C++: 如果你是初学者,这款工具非常适合你!Dev-C++操作简单,安装包小,启动速度快,特别适合用来练习基础语法和小型项目开发。虽然功能相对有限,但对于新手来说已经足够用了!🌟
3️⃣ Code::Blocks: 这是一个开源的跨平台C/C++集成开发环境,内置编译器支持,配置简单,适合快速上手。它的调试功能也很强大,可以帮助你找出代码中的错误。如果你喜欢折腾各种设置,Code::Blocks绝对值得一试!🔧
4️⃣ Eclipse CDT: Eclipse是Java开发者的老朋友了,而CDT插件则让它摇身一变成为C/C++开发利器!它拥有丰富的功能模块,比如代码补全、静态分析和性能调优等,适合需要处理复杂项目的开发者。不过,由于体积较大,可能对电脑性能有一定要求哦!💪
5️⃣ CLion: 由JetBrains公司出品的CLion堪称高端大气上档次!它提供了智能代码补全、实时错误检测以及强大的重构功能,让编码变得更加流畅。不过,这款工具是收费的,学生党可以申请教育版优惠哦!💰
6️⃣ Sublime Text: Sublime Text以其极快的速度和高度可定制性闻名。虽然它本身不是专门为C语言设计的,但通过安装相关插件,也能很好地支持C语言开发。如果你追求极致效率,不妨试试看!🚀

三、如何选择适合自己的C语言开发工具?🤔

怎么挑选适合自己的C语言开发工具呢?,这取决于你的需求和水平:

1. 初学者优先考虑:

如果你刚刚接触C语言,建议从简单易用的工具开始,比如Dev-C++或Code::Blocks。这些工具能够让你专注于学习语言本身,而不需要花太多时间在环境搭建上。😎

2. 中级开发者推荐:

当你的技能逐渐提升时,可以尝试更专业的工具,例如VS Code + C/C++插件组合。这种方案灵活且高效,能满足大多数日常开发需求。同时,你还可以学习一些高级技巧,比如使用Makefile构建项目或者配置远程调试环境。💡

3. 高级开发者进阶:

对于那些需要处理大型复杂工程的专业人士来说,Eclipse CDT或CLion可能是更好的选择。它们提供了更全面的功能集,有助于优化工作流程并提高生产力。当然,这也意味着你需要投入更多时间去熟悉它们的各项特性。⏳

四、常见问题答疑时间💬

关于C语言开发工具还有其他疑问吗?,下面解答几个大家经常问到的问题:
1️⃣ Q: “我可以用Notepad++写C语言程序吗?”
A: 当然可以!Notepad++本质上是一个文本编辑器,但它支持基本的语法高亮显示。不过,它不具备编译和调试功能,因此你需要额外安装一个独立的编译器(如GCC)来完成整个开发流程。😅
2️⃣ Q: “为什么我的程序总是报错?”
A: 很多时候是因为环境配置不正确导致的。确保你已经正确安装了编译器,并且将其路径添加到了系统变量中。此外,检查代码是否符合标准规范也是很重要的一步哦!🔍
3️⃣ Q: “有没有移动端的C语言开发工具?”
A: 现在确实存在一些针对手机和平板设备设计的应用程序,比如AIDE(Android Integrated Development Environment)。不过,受限于硬件条件,它们通常无法完全替代桌面端工具。如果条件允许的话,还是建议在电脑上进行主要开发工作。📱

五、总结:找到属于你的那把“宝剑”⚔️

无论是入门级的Dev-C++,还是旗舰级的CLion,每一款C语言开发工具都有其独特的魅力。关键在于根据自己的实际情况做出明智的选择。
最后提醒一句:工具固然重要,但更重要的是不断练习与积累经验。只有通过亲手实践,才能真正掌握这门神奇的语言!💻✨
所以,赶快行动起来吧!选好你的第一把“宝剑”,开启激动人心的C语言冒险之旅!Adventure awaits! 🌟


TAG:教育 | c语言 | c语言 | 开发工具 | 编程学习 | 代码编辑器 | 开发者工具
文章链接:https://www.9educ.com/cyuyan/274522.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
c语言开发工具有哪些?🤔新手必备神器推荐
从初学者到专业开发者,C语言开发工具种类繁多。本文为你盘点主流的C语言开发工具,并结合实际使用体
c语言要学什么?🔥初学者必看的C语言学习
从零基础到掌握C语言,你需要了解哪些核心知识点?本文为你梳理C语言学习路径,涵盖语法、数据结构与
Coding Prodigy 🚀 - C
准备好踏上编程的奇妙之旅吗?菜鸟们,C语言不再是遥不可及的梦想!📚🎉 这篇全面的入门教程将带你在
c语言代码大全哪里找?新手小白必看!💻
针对初学者对c语言代码大全的需求,从学习资源、经典案例到实战技巧全面解析,帮助你快速掌握c语言核
c语言变量的本质是什么?🤔为什么变量能存
深入解析C语言中变量的本质,探讨变量如何与内存交互、存储数据的原理,并结合实际案例帮助初学者理解
教育本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。
Encyclopediaknowledge
菜谱食谱美食穿搭文化sneaker球鞋街头奢侈品时尚百科养生健康彩妆美妆化妆品美容问答国外海外攻略古迹名胜景区景点旅行旅游学校大学英语移民留学学习教育篮球足球主播导演明星动漫综艺电视剧电影影视科技潮牌品牌生活家电健身旅游数码美丽体育汽车游戏娱乐潮流网红热榜知识